Where Exactly Is This Place?

San Marino is nestled in the heart of Los Angeles County, just southeast of Pasadena. It's like the little sister to Beverly Hills, but with a bit less flash and a lot more privacy. If you're familiar with the area, think Huntington Library and Gardens. That's San Marino's backyard.

How to Find San Marino

  • How to get to San Marino: The easiest way is by car. It's about a 20-minute drive from downtown Los Angeles. If you're feeling adventurous, you can take the Metro Gold Line to Pasadena and then grab a taxi or rideshare.
  • How to explore San Marino: The Huntington Library and Gardens is a must-visit. You could spend an entire day there. If you're looking for something a bit more active, there are plenty of hiking trails in the nearby San Gabriel Mountains.
